Output 16bdfb1939bfda695d3ca8e7c4f153cff83f9b14457ed2183c9aaac638dbbf87:1

value
2186000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e45b7d9039a191afa6b911bf1fe15f4974169435 OP_EQUAL
address
3NWTb9ixGW83wPKjbsX81GmbMHWf2HsznK
transaction
16bdfb1939bfda695d3ca8e7c4f153cff83f9b14457ed2183c9aaac638dbbf87
confirmations
187672
spent
true